Richard WELCH (North-Eastern Metropolitan) (12:41): (1086) My constituency matter is for the Minister for Education. Recently I had the pleasure of meeting with Koonung Secondary College and principal Andrew McNeil. As principal, Mr McNeil has provided strong leadership and vision, driving upgrades and rebuilds of the 1960s-built Koonung Secondary. An important step in this case is the addition of eight new classrooms and open learning spaces. However, there is a problem: the first half of the building was completed, and then subsequently Melbourne Water changed the flood zoning, meaning a farcical situation where the second half of the same building has to be higher than the first, significantly adding to cost, delay and loss of utility of the building. I ask that the minister intervene and speak with the Victorian School Building Authority and Melbourne Water to ensure the second half of the building can be grandfathered under the approvals that existed at the commencement of stage 1 and ensure a commonsense solution to the problem for the school and the school community.
